Output 72160ee22ac4411d77ce33db6cdf625a075bfaa3643a407d04718c287b0d9eaa:35

value
9428536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 353c689f19e42782356cca40073936b26878072b OP_EQUAL
address
MCkeQsAVvWNSLkYxKgJeGz9tdAfDqkB5pw
transaction
72160ee22ac4411d77ce33db6cdf625a075bfaa3643a407d04718c287b0d9eaa
spent
true